A few more images showing the superb sunset conjunction. This time, besides the "normal" sunset images, I have uploaded another pair, acquired during daytime, when the true conjunction took place. The images were acquired at 12:17 U.T. The Moon was invisible even on single frames, mainly, I think, due to the cirrus clouds that covered the area of the two celestial objects. Only when I got back home and started processing all of the 168 frames I did notice the very thin crescent. The daytime images were acquired using a 4.5" APO Refractor @F/7 and Canon 550D at ISO 100 and 1/4000s exposures. There is also an enhanced B-W version which shows better the crescent.
